PORTWEST, a leading global manufacturer of safety wear, workwear and PPE, is currently seeking applications for the position of Warehouse Team Leader based in Sulbiate on a permanent basis reporting to the Operations Mnager. Founded in 1904, Portwest has become one of the fastest growing workwear companies in the world, employing over 6,000 staff worldwide. With 1400 styles across more than 20 ranges, we design, manufacture and distribute market leading products globally. We are on a mission to become the world’s most requested PPE and Safety Wear brand. JOB SUMMARY: We are seeking a hands-on Warehouse Team Leader to support the setup and day-to-day operations of a new warehouse facility. This role will act as the first-line leader for warehouse operatives and forklift drivers, ensuring efficient shift execution across inbound, storage and outbound activities. The Team Leader will play a critical role in establishing operational standards, driving productivity, and maintaining a strong health and safety culture in a fast-paced PPE environment. The successful candidate will combine strong people leadership with a hands-on approach, actively supporting warehouse tasks when required. Working closely with the Warehouse Shift Manager and Operations Manager, this role will be key to building a high-performing team in a growing operation. KEY RESPONSIBILITIES: Lead and coordinate warehouse activities for the assigned shift, including goods-in, order picking, packing, replenishment, and dispatch. Supervise, motivate, and support the team to achieve shift targets and operational KPIs. Allocate workloads effectively to meet productivity and accuracy standards. Ensure compliance with health & safety policies, hygiene regulations, and PPE handling procedures at all times. Conduct shift briefings and debriefs to communicate priorities, updates, and safety reminders. Monitor team performance and address issues such as absenteeism, performance gaps, or training needs.
